VINYL MELTDOWN NO. 4
Joey’s Place, Part 2.
On the next installation of Vinyl Meltdown, Joey Altruda welcomes special guest Jeff West (bassist for Big Sandy & The Flyrite Boys, Ramblin James & The Billy Boppers, and The Sun Demons).
West spins his favorite stack of records from his childhood, featuring an insane mish-mash of Philadelphia Sounds, British Invasion, Rockabilly, Wacky Novelty, and TV Themes. Altruda serves as a perfect foil for his guest, providing his special brand of witty repartee in a hilarious jaw wagging session between selections. VINYL MELTDOWN NO. 3
Live Los Angeles: 1938-1968.
Joey Altruda holds court with Domenic Priore—LA music historian, sociologist, and author of Riot On The Sunset Strip, Smile—The Story Of Brian Wilson’s Lost Masterpiece, Beatsville, Dumb Angel #4, All Summer Long, etc. Priore takes you on a tour of famous Los Angeles clubs featuring live performances from 1938-1968. This is a fascinating journey spanning three decades of musical genres: Swing, Bebop, Beat Generation, Folk, Surf, Gogo, Soul, Psychedelia and more.

VINYL MELTDOWN NO. 1
Joey’s Place
Los Angeles native and music aficionado Joey Altruda hosts his new show, Vinyl Meltdown, on Reserve Radio. Joey has been a fixture on the LA music scene since the early 80’s with his previous bands Tupelo Chain Sex, Joey Altruda’s Mambo Noir Orchestra and Jump With Joey, along with compositional scores for motion pictures. He also owns the longest running recording studio here in LA, formerly known as Electro Vox Studios and now is known as Joey’s Place.
